Of all the recent Madballs releases, the 4″ scale foam Madballs by Kidrobot were my most anticipated. This assortment of classically styled Madballs are similar sculpts to our previously reviewed Blind Box Madballs Mini-Figures and the Madballs Keychains. Standing about 4″ tall each, these are made of a very dense foam and feature highly detailed sculpts at a collector friendly price. Included in the assortment are:
- Screamin’ Meemie
- Skull Face
- Slobulous
- Horn Head
- Oculus Orbus
- Dust Brain

Overall
Now this is what I’ve been waiting for. As much as I enjoyed the Madballs mini-figures, the 4″ foam versions were the ones I had my eye on from the beginning. Each Madball comes in a nylon net package with a cardboard hanging tag. The very minimalistic packaging approach is all about showcasing the individual Madballs. Though, once opened there’s no point in keeping the packaging at all.
The Madballs themselves are essentially perfect. At 4″ they’re larger than the original 80’s versions. These are a little larger than a softball, while the classic ones were tennis ball sized. As with the smaller ones released by Kidrobot, the design and sculpts are top notch. Details are sharply sculpted and the faces are as creepy, funny and grotesque as can be. There’s a bit of mold flashing on a few of them, but that’s expected on this type of all foam release. After reviewing the smaller releases, I expected these to have stellar paint jobs, and I wasn’t disappointed. the paint lines are mostly clean, with just a bit of bleed on a few of them, with Oculus Orbus being the most noticeable. The colors, though, are bright and enhance the sculpts nicely. There’s a very dark paint wash over each one, filling in each crack and crevice, punching up the gritty look of the Madballs. Overall they looks awesome in hand and are by far my favorite of the Kidrobot releases.
Fans will be happy to know that getting these 4″ versions won’t break the bank. they are priced at $9.99 each, which is the same price for the smaller cartoon style Madballs by Just Play. So for the same price you get a larger, more detailed and classically styled version of each character. Check out some highlight photos below with the full gallery after that.
